Night Float Week
I've been on night float all week long for OB/Gyn rotation. Honestly, it's been such a rough week. I can't talk about the specifics but some of the deliveries have been really tough. As a medical student, my responsibilities are limited but I still feel the weight of things. Around the hospital, there's always a lot of finger pointing when anything goes wrong and no one really does anything about it. Anyways, I learned a lot this week in terms of what is my responsibility and what isn't. Sometimes we just have to learn to be smart and protect ourselves while protecting the right of our patients. Ultimately, I don't want to lose sight of why I am doing what I am doing. When we see the tears of joy in the eyes of our patients, we understand that this is what is most important. It's going to be a tough road ahead but I just want to remind myself from time to time that ultimately, we have to do what we believe is right, no matter how much pressure and prejudice we face in the workplace. Some things aren't our fault and there is nothing we can do to change the outcome. Understanding this simple fact allows me to divert my energy elsewhere rather than waste time worrying and losing sleep. On the bright side, I helped deliver around 15 babies this week. Last night we received 16 babies and I delivered 4 of them. There was this tiny one with a big head that cries really loud. He was so precious and reminds me of a peanut. We can hear him all the way down the hallway. Anyway, all the babies are super cute. I haven't seen one that wasn't cute. As to what I want to be, the answer is I don't know yet. I really don't know. Whatever I am good at and also happen to like. I think patient interaction is really important to me and so I want to choose a field that allows me to follow my patients and get to know them rather than just performing procedures.
